Willie Jenkins, Jr., 73, son of Corine Jenkins and the late Willie Jenkins, Sr., was born on January 29, 1947 in Sumter County. He departed this earthly life on Saturday, May 2, 2020. He was educated in the public schools of Sumter County. Willie was employed with Carolina Furniture and Korn Industries for several years before retiring. He was a faithful member of Union Station A. M. E. Church, where he served as a member of the Trustee Board, Sons of Allen and Male Chorus.
